Gurugram, January 29, 2025 – A2Z Infra Engineering Limited has disclosed a
Goods and Services Tax (GST) demand of ₹1,97,88,932 for the
financial year 2019-20, following a notice issued by the
Assistant Commissioner, GST & Central Excise, Bhubaneswar-I Division.
Key Details of the GST Demand
- Authority: Assistant Commissioner, GST & Central Excise, Bhubaneswar-I Division
- Penalty Amount: ₹1,97,88,932 (₹1.97 crore)
- Violation: Penalty imposed under Section 122(1)(vii) of CGST/OGST Act, 2017 and Section 122(1)(ii) of CGST Act, 2017 read with Section 122(2)(a) of IGST Act, 2017.
- Date of Receipt of Notice: January 28, 2025
Impact on the Company
Despite the substantial penalty,
A2Z Infra Engineering has stated that the demand notice will not have any material impact on its financials, operations, or other activities. The company is expected to address the demand through appropriate legal and compliance measures.
Regulatory Disclosure
This disclosure follows
Regulation 30 of the S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015, ensuring transparency with stakeholders. The information was submitted to both
BSE Limited (Scrip Code: 533292) and NSE (Scrip Code: A2ZINFRA).
